#Load a CNOlist
data(CNOlistToy,package="CellNOptR")
#Replace the values in the list by random values
#(for demonstration purposes, when actually using this function you would simply load a non-normalised CNOlist)
CNOlistToy$valueSignals$t0<-matrix(
data=runif(n=(dim(CNOlistToy$valueSignals$t0)[1]*dim(CNOlistToy$valueSignals$t0)[2]),min=0,max=400),
nrow=dim(CNOlistToy$valueSignals$t0)[1],
ncol=dim(CNOlistToy$valueSignals$t0)[2])
CNOlistToy$valueSignals[[2]]<-CNOlistToy$valueSignals[[1]]+matrix(
data=runif(n=(dim(CNOlistToy$valueSignals$t0)[1]*dim(CNOlistToy$valueSignals$t0)[2]),min=0,max=100),
nrow=dim(CNOlistToy$valueSignals$t0)[1],
ncol=dim(CNOlistToy$valueSignals$t0)[2])
CNOlistToyN<-normaliseCNOlist(
CNOlistToy,
EC50Data = 0.5,
HillCoef = 2,
EC50Noise = 0.1,
detection = 0,
saturation = Inf,
changeTh = 0,
mode = "time")
Run the code above in your browser using DataLab